Working from air purification technology developed by NASA, the Air Oasis team of researchers has further expanded on the possibilities of AHPCO (advanced hydrated photocatalytic oxidation) air purification.

The AHPCO technology inside of each Air Oasis unit relies on photocatalysis, or light energy, to “zap” unwanted particles from the air. Unlike most PCO catalyst systems, the signature AHPCO catalyst in Air Oasis units features six rare catalyst metals. To purify the air even quicker, the Air Oasis system also features special hydrating agents, which increase the reaction’s kinetic rate. All of Air Oasis’ air purifiers use the same landmark technology that is simply applied to various room sizes. For very small spaces, such as automobiles, bathrooms, or hotel rooms, the most basic Air Oasis system is also designed for maximum portability. Families can easily bring these smaller units on vacation. At the other end of the spectrum, the highest impact units that Air Oasis offers can be fitted to an HVAC system, thereby most efficiently providing clean air to larger offices, warehouses, or entire homes.

Since the G3 Series units are filterless, no routine maintenance or cleaning is needed. After about two years of use, an alarm will indicate when the AHPCO cell requires changing. The provided 12VDC wall adapter makes it easy to plug in the unit, wherever you are (even abroad).
